Ahangaran-e Kaviani ( Persian: اهنگران كاوياني, also Romanized as Āhangarān-e Kāvīānī; also known as Āhangarān) [1] is a village in Hendmini Rural District, Badreh District, Darreh Shahr County, Ilam Province, Iran. At the 2006 census, its population was 155, in 33 families. [2] The village is populated by Lurs. [3]
